
TSSA is an independent, UK-based trade union for the transport and travel trade industries. We have 30,000 members in the UK and Ireland, working for the railways and associated companies.
TSSA has had members in Ireland since the late 1890s; our first branch was formed in Belfast in November 1904.
We represent salaried staff in many different undertakings, and TSSA's affairs are managed by an Irish Committee, elected by the entire membership in the Republic of Ireland and Northern Ireland.
